What is a soft wash machine?
A soft wash machine is a type of pressure washer that uses a lower pressure setting than traditional pressure washers. This lower pressure allows for a gentler cleaning process that is safe for use on delicate surfaces such as vinyl siding, stucco, and painted surfaces. Soft wash machines typically use a mixture of water, cleaning solution, and low-pressure spray to effectively clean surfaces without causing damage.
Benefits of Using a soft wash machine
There are several benefits to using a soft wash machine for your cleaning needs. One of the main advantages is its ability to clean delicate surfaces without causing damage. Traditional pressure washers can be too harsh for surfaces like vinyl siding or painted walls, leading to damage such as peeling or chipping. Soft wash machines provide a gentler cleaning solution that is safe and effective.
Another benefit of using a soft wash machine is its versatility. These machines can be used for a variety of cleaning tasks, including cleaning exterior walls, roofs, sidewalks, and even vehicles. The adjustable pressure settings and nozzle options make it easy to tailor the cleaning process to suit the specific needs of each surface.
Soft wash machines are also more environmentally friendly than traditional pressure washers. By using lower pressure and a mixture of water and cleaning solution, soft wash machines use less water and chemicals, reducing the impact on the environment. This makes them a sustainable choice for eco-conscious consumers.
How to Use a soft wash machine
Using a soft wash machine is a relatively simple process, but it does require some preparation and care to ensure effective cleaning without causing damage. Here are some steps to follow when using a soft wash machine:
1. Prepare the cleaning solution: Depending on the surface you are cleaning, you may need to prepare a cleaning solution to use with your soft wash machine. Make sure to follow the manufacturer’s instructions for mixing the solution properly.
2. Connect the machine: Attach the cleaning solution container and hose to the soft wash machine according to the manufacturer’s instructions. Make sure all connections are secure before turning on the machine.
3. Test the pressure: Before starting to clean a surface, test the pressure settings on a small, inconspicuous area to ensure it is not too harsh for the surface. Adjust the pressure as needed to achieve the desired cleaning results.
4. Begin cleaning: Start at the top of the surface you are cleaning and work your way down, using a sweeping motion to evenly distribute the cleaning solution. Avoid spraying directly at seams or edges to prevent damage.
5. Rinse the surface: Once you have finished applying the cleaning solution, rinse the surface thoroughly with water to remove any leftover residue. Make sure to rinse from top to bottom to prevent streaking.
6. Dry the surface: Allow the surface to air dry or use a soft cloth to gently dry it if needed. Avoid using high-pressure air or heat, as this can damage the surface.
